Company overview

Michael Baker International is a global engineering and consulting firm specializing in infrastructure, environmental, architectural, and program management services. The company generates revenue through government contracts, private sector projects, and public-private partnerships. Founded in 1940, Michael Baker International has a rich history of contributing to significant projects such as the Interstate Highway System and various military installations. Their expertise spans transportation, water, energy, and community planning, making them a key player in shaping modern infrastructure.
